VP, Global Corporate Controller

Reporting to the CFO, the Global Corporate Controller assumes full responsibility of the accounting department to include overseeing and developing staff, administrative and compliance duties, and ensuring that protocol is always followed. This position will need to scale operations to fit new goals (or financial strains) and design new procedures to satisfy changing compliance laws as well as focus on how we can maximize the Company's financial health by implementing and enforcing best practices.

In this role you will:
  • Embrace the Company's Servant Leadership philosophy by coaching and supervising the accounting staff to ensure they are adequately performing their duties and growing & developing their skillsets in order to support the business.
  • Be a change agent and will establish a world-class accounting function complete with scalable processes and systems. To include revamping /creating SOPS which are currently insufficient, ineffective, or nonexistent.
  • Properly implement new accounting principals (due to business changes or regulatory changes) such as ASC 815 (Hedge Accounting) and ASC 842 (Lease Accounting), or updating accounting principals that may have been deficient in prior year's such as ASC 740 (Uncertain Tax Positions).
  • Own the month-end (and year-end) closing process, which includes joining the daily closing calls, reviewing and scrubbing the balance sheet, cash flows, and P&L to ensure there are no material misstatements (and minimizing out-of-period adjustments).
  • Implement/update appropriate internal controls within the accounting department to minimize risk and ensure that the department is performing its duties.
  • Own the Monthly Invoicing Process to ensure monthly invoices are generated accurately, timely, and in accordance with our clients' MSAs/SOWs.
  • Manage the Accounts Receivable Collections Process to ensure that accounts receivables are timely and accurately collected per the terms of our clients' MSAs.
  • Manage cash flows by ensuring that optimal DSO is calculated and measured against actual DSO. Provide the Client Solutions or Account Operations Teams (the primary client POCs) the appropriate visibility and reporting to optimizing the collections of cash (including developing new strategies and SOPs). This also includes developing an appropriate Accounts Receivable Reserve Policy.
  • Oversee the process of employee reimbursements (which includes receipt, verification, feeding, filing, following-up and tallying).
  • Oversee the process of vendor payments/ accounts payable lifecycle to ensure that only valid vendor payments are made timely.
  • Ensure compliance with all accounting and reporting requirements, prescribed by relevant regulatory bodies and Management, at all levels of operation.
  • Manage all monthly, quarterly and yearly statutory and regulatory filings in all geographies.
  • Be the primary point of contact and leading both the internal and external audits of the Company.
  • Prepare written responses for all internal and external audit comments that go to the Audit Committee.
  • Oversee and review the filings of the Company's state, federal, and international taxes and various tax issues like VAT and PEZA.
  • Manage the process in obtaining the appropriate valuation reports for LTIP, Purchase Price Allocation, and Organizational Restructuring.
  • Review and sign off the mon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ements to ensure that they are presented accurately with no material misstatements and are incompliance with GAAP, IFRS, or local statutory requirements (as appropriate)
  • Manage the appropriate accounting steps that need to take place during acquisitions.
  • Analyze accounts and making formal recommendations as to how the Company can minimize losses and inefficiencies.
  • Attend necessary continuing education seminars and maintain required licensing and certifications
  • Implement MIS reporting mechanism as necessary
  • Implement or revamp the ERP system to optimize and automate accounting functions/processes and ERP system reporting.
  • Manage the payroll cycle cradle to grave, including timely disbursements and off-cycle payments.
  • Report risk issues and proposed solutions to the CFO timely.
We are looking for someone who has:
  • 15+ years of experience in general accounting
  • 5+ years of experience in a senior position
  • Must have experience in leading the accounting function in a BPO environment
  • Thorough understanding of current compliance regulations
  • Excellent leadership and organizational skills
  • Excellent communication and coaching skills
  • Strong ability to use a variety of accounting and reporting software
  • Advanced MS Excel skills
  • Experience drafting reports and preparing budgets and financial forecasts
  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ting-related field
  • Ability to increase employee job satisfaction and employee engagement through leadership, coaching, and development of the team.
